1. 三极管过压保护电路设计解析
作为一名嵌入式硬件工程师,我在设计电源模块时经常需要处理过压保护问题。今天要分享的这个三极管过压保护电路,是我在多个项目中验证过的可靠方案,成本不到1元钱却能有效保护后端电路。
这个电路的核心思想是利用二极管的导通特性和三极管的开关特性,当输入电压超过设定阈值时自动切断输出。相比专用保护IC,这个方案具有成本低、响应快、可定制性强的特点,特别适合对成本敏感的小型嵌入式设备。
1.1 电路功能与核心器件选型
电路的主要功能是在输入电压超过预设值时快速切断输出,保护后端负载。实现这一功能需要三个关键器件:
-
稳压二极管(D1):这是整个电路的"电压传感器",我常用1N4728A(3.3V)或1N4733A(5.1V),具体选择取决于你需要的保护阈值。例如:
- 选择3.3V稳压管时,保护阈值≈3.3V+0.7V(三极管BE结压降)=4V
- 选择5.1V稳压管时,保护阈值≈5.1V+0.7V=5.8V
-
NPN三极管(Q1):作为电压检测开关,我推荐使用通用型2N3904或S8050,这类管子价格低廉且参数稳定。关键参数要求:
- VCEO≥输入电压最大值
- hFE≥100(保证可靠导通)
-
PNP三极管(Q2):作为功率开关管,根据负载电流选择型号。小电流(<500mA)可用S8550,大电流(1A左右)建议用BD140。选型时需注意:
- VCEO必须高于最大输入电压
- IC电流要留足余量(建议按实际电流的2倍选型)
提示:实际设计中,稳压管的功率建议选择1W以上(如1N4728A是1W),避免长时间过压时烧毁。三极管的封装也要根据功耗选择,TO-92适用于200mW以下,更大功率建议用TO-126或TO-220。
1.2 电路工作原理深度解析
让我们拆解这个电路的工作过程(假设使用5.1V稳压管):
正常工作情况(Vin<5.8V):
- 输入电压Vin低于5.8V时,D1不导通
- Q1基极无电流,处于截止状态
- Q2基极通过R2获得偏置电压,Q2导通
- 输出电压Vout≈Vin-0.3V(Q2饱和压降)
过压保护状态(Vin≥5.8V):
- 当Vin上升到5.8V时,D1击穿导通
- 电流经D1→R1→Q1基极,Q1导通
- Q1导通后,Q2基极被拉低至接近GND
- Q2立即截止,切断输出
这个过程的响应时间主要取决于三极管的开关速度,实测2N3904+S8550组合的响应时间<1μs,能有效保护敏感器件。
2. 详细设计参数与计算
2.1 电阻参数计算
电路中有两个关键电阻需要精确计算:
R1计算(Q1基极限流电阻):
- 作用:限制流过D1和Q1基极的电流
- 计算公式:R1=(Vin-Vz-Vbe)/Ib
- Vz:稳压管击穿电压
- Vbe:Q1基极-发射极电压(约0.7V)
- Ib:Q1基极电流(通常取1-5mA)
举例:Vin=12V,Vz=5.1V,取Ib=3mA
R1=(12-5.1-0.7)/0.003≈2kΩ
实际可选择2.2kΩ/0.25W电阻
R2计算(Q2基极下拉电阻):
- 作用:确保Q2在Q1截止时可靠导通
- 取值原则:使Q2基极电流足够维持饱和
- 经验值:通常取4.7kΩ-10kΩ
2.2 器件参数验证
设计完成后需要验证几个关键参数:
-
Q1功耗验证:
P_Q1=Vce×Ic≈(Vin-Vout)×(Iload/hFE)
以Vin=12V,Iload=500mA,hFE=100为例:
P_Q1≈(12-11.7)×(0.5/100)=1.5mW(安全) -
Q2功耗验证:
正常导通时:
P_Q2=Vce(sat)×Iload≈0.3V×0.5A=150mW
需要确认封装散热能力(TO-92约200mW) -
D1电流验证:
Iz=(Vin-Vz)/R1=(12-5.1)/2200≈3.1mA
查1N4733A规格书,最小稳定工作电流为1mA,满足要求
3. 实际应用中的优化技巧
3.1 提高保护精度的方法
基础电路存在约±0.5V的阈值偏差,可通过以下方法提高精度:
-
使用可调基准源代替稳压管:
- 用TL431替代D1
- 通过电阻分压精确设置保护阈值
- 可将精度提高到±50mV
-
添加正反馈加速关断:
- 在Q1集电极和D1阳极间加100kΩ电阻
- 过压时形成正反馈,加快保护动作
3.2 大电流应用改进
当负载电流>1A时,建议进行以下改进:
-
改用MOSFET输出:
- 用PMOS(如AO3401)替代Q2
- 导通电阻低(约50mΩ),减少压降损耗
-
增加散热措施:
- 给功率管加散热片
- 在PCB上预留足够铜箔散热
-
添加缓冲电路:
- 在输出端加100μF电解电容
- 防止感性负载产生的电压尖峰
4. 常见问题与解决方案
4.1 保护后无法自动恢复
现象:触发保护后,即使输入电压恢复正常,输出仍不恢复
原因分析:
- Q1基极残留电荷导致持续导通
- 负载端有储能电容导致电压下降缓慢
解决方案:
- 在Q1基极对地加100nF电容加速放电
- 在R2上并联1μF电容,延迟Q2导通
- 增加手动复位按钮
4.2 小电流负载时保护不动作
现象:轻载时过压保护阈值偏高
原因:Q2的hFE随电流减小而降低,导致基极电流需求变化
解决方案:
- 减小R2阻值(如改为2.2kΩ)
- 改用hFE线性更好的三极管(如BC847)
- 在输出端加假负载电阻(如1kΩ)
4.3 频繁误触发
现象:没有过压时电路误保护
可能原因:
- 输入电压有高频噪声
- 稳压管温度系数影响
- 电阻值漂移
解决方法:
- 在输入端加0.1μF陶瓷电容滤波
- 选择温度系数小的稳压管(如1N5221B)
- 使用1%精度的金属膜电阻
5. PCB设计注意事项
在实际布局时,有几个关键点需要注意:
-
地线布置:
- Q1和Q2的发射极接地线要短而粗
- 避免保护电路和负载共用地线回路
-
热设计:
- Q2要远离热源放置
- 大电流走线宽度≥1mm/A
-
测试点预留:
- 在D1阴极、Q1基极、Q2集电极预留测试点
- 方便调试时测量关键电压
-
元件间距:
- 稳压管与发热元件保持距离
- 高压部分与其他线路保持≥1mm间距
我在多个项目中验证过这个电路,包括:
- 车载设备电源保护(12V系统)
- 锂电池供电设备过充保护
- 工控设备电源输入保护
实测保护响应时间在0.5-2μs之间,完全能满足大多数嵌入式设备的保护需求。一个实际案例是为某传感器设计保护电路,使用3.3V稳压管,当电源适配器故障导致电压升至6V时,电路在0.8μs内切断输出,成功保护了价值200多元的传感器模块。